So I went through options one by one and finally > discovered that the "Wake by Thunderbolt 3" option makes the difference. > It has the following description: > "Enable/Disable Wake Feature with Thunderbolt 3 ports. If Enabled, the > battery life during low power state may become shorter." > It is enabled by default, I had it disabled before. When I enable it, I > have a 5 sec resume even with Secure Connect TB security level. The dmesg > for such a resume is here: > [2]https://bugzilla-attachments.redhat.com/attachment.cgi?id=1990815 Okay that now looks like what is expected. The firmware re-connects the tunnels and the resume can continue. I actually don't know what that option does either but I would expect that it leaves the PME and small power enabled for the port so that probably allows the firmware to do this even in "secure" mode or so. > I'm sorry I haven't spotted and tested such an obviously named option > earlier.
